Landing The Best Places to Get a $4,000 Personal Loan
A $4,000 personal loan can offer you the cash flexibility you need for unexpected bills or important purchases. But with so many financial institutions out there, finding the best deal can be tough. To help you get started, look into these popular alternatives:
- Online lenders often provide quick decision times and favorable interest rates. Some popular examples include LendingClub, Prosper, and Upstart.
- Established banks often have better member support but may have stricter credit requirements.
- Credit unions are community-based organizations that often offer lower interest terms and more dedicated service.
Be aware to review multiple proposals before choosing a decision. Furthermore, meticulously scrutinize the agreement details to understand the full cost of your loan.
Managing Your $4,000 Loan Repayments Effectively
Taking on a $4,000 loan can be a major financial commitment. To ensure you handle repayments smoothly and avoid pressure, consider these essential tips. Assign a specific amount each month for loan repayments, ensuring it's sustainable within your budget. Consider setting up automatic payments to avoid missed payments and possible penalties.
Communicate your lender if you encounter any challenges in making repayments. They may be able to offer flexible payment options or a short-term forbearance plan. Remember, open dialogue is key to finding a solution that works for both parties.
Finally, strive to discharge your loan as promptly as possible to minimize costs accumulated over time. By utilizing these strategies, you can effectively manage your $4,000 loan repayments and realize financial well-being.
